How to Make Twisted Bacon
This technique couldn’t be easier. It’s honestly super simple. Take a single piece of bacon and twist it in an upwards motion so it resembles a straight line (not wrapped around itself like a piece of sushi). Then, take your pieces of bacon and line them up side-by-side on a parchment-lined baking sheet.
Pop them in the oven for around 20 minutes at 350°. Then, when the timer goes off, flip the twists and bake for another 20 minutes …
